Technically great Blu-ray just OK movie
||Posted .This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.Despite being a visually stunning film, this is likely one of the weaker X-Men films, which is to say it's quite weak. Over a span of 9 films, the X-Men franchise has had its fair share of highs and lows. Following the soft reboot with First Class, Bryan Singer came back to direct the surprisingly solid Days of Future Past, which successfully blended the casts of both generations of films and offered a fun reset to the muddled continuity. As a fan of the Age of Apocalypse series of comics produced in the 90's, I had high hopes for this film. Unfortunately what we have here is an incredibly generic summer blockbuster, high on action and destruction, low on thoughtful story and we'll developed characters. That's not to say this is a total failure. If you're looking for fun mindless flicks, this should fill your need. It also happens to be a visually stunning Blu-ray and one with first rate 3D. Overall this was a largely disappointing film but one that looks great and a disc that will wow your friends if you want to show off your system.

Decent movie, but not the best
||Posted .This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.It's a decent film, though it feels very phoned-in and not nearly as good as the two previous X-Men films (First Class and Days of Future Past). It suffers from a "been there, done that" story, coupled with an obvious push to force Jennifer Lawrence to the lead role, a role which comes off flat and unconvincing. Essentially, it looks like she did it just to fulfill her contract. The spectacle is there, but very hollow, and there is a lacking sense of drive or purpose to the story. I think the writers just shoe-horned characters in (including an unnecessary Wolverine cameo), and then proceeds to make them completely underused. It's never really clear why Apocalypse chooses Storm and Angel to be part of his horsemen when there are much more powerful mutants (Professor X, Quicksilver, Wolverine, among many others). I'd recommend the previous films and only pick this up if you really feel like you need to. Uninspired would be my one word of choice for this one. But the steel book case is really nice, so there's that.
